PISCATAWAY, N.J. – Rutgers baseball opens Big Ten play this weekend when it hosts Michigan State for a three-game set at Bainton Field. It marks the first home series of the season for RU, who spent the first six weekends of the season on the road.
The Spartans are 14-8 and opened conference play last weekend by taking 2-of-3 from Purdue at home. They defeated Western Michigan on the road by a score of 8-6 on Tuesday.
Rutgers was swept last weekend at UConn and picked up a 9-7 victory over NJIT at home on Wednesday.
RU will run back the same rotation for the fourth straight week, with Drew Conover starting game one on Friday, true freshman Christian Coppola starting game two and Jake Marshall starting on Sunday.
